Exploring Hermitage, Missouri: Top Things to Do



1. Visit Pomme de Terre Lake


One of the most popular attractions in Hermitage is Pomme de Terre Lake. This beautiful lake offers opportunities for fishing, boating, swimming, and picnicking. You can also enjoy hiking along the scenic trails surrounding the lake.



2. Tour the Hickory County Historical Museum


Learn about the rich history of the area by visiting the Hickory County Historical Museum. Explore exhibits showcasing artifacts, photographs, and documents that highlight the heritage of Hermitage and the surrounding region.

6. Explore the Outdoors at Pomme de Terre State Park


For even more outdoor adventures, head to Pomme de Terre State Park. This expansive park offers opportunities for camping, hiking, bird watching, and water sports. Don't forget to snap photos of the stunning scenery.
